CDN 多路灾备是一种通过在多个数据中心之间分散流量,以提高网站可用性和性能的技术,这种技术可以确保在某个数据中心出现故障时,用户仍然可以从其他数据中心获取内容,从而保证网站的正常运行,本文将详细介绍 CDN 多路灾备的原理、实施步骤以及相关问题与解答。
一、CDN 多路灾备原理
1. 分布式架构
CDN 多路灾备采用分布式架构,将流量在全球范围内的多个数据中心之间进行分配,当某个数据中心出现故障时,用户流量可以自动切换到其他正常的数据中心,从而实现故障的自动隔离和恢复。
2. 负载均衡
CDN 多路灾备通过负载均衡技术,将用户流量平均分配到各个数据中心,这样可以确保每个数据中心的负载相对均衡,避免因某个数据中心过载而导致整个网络系统崩溃。
3. 数据同步
CDN 多路灾备需要在各个数据中心之间进行数据同步,以确保用户访问的内容是最新的,这通常通过心跳检测和增量更新等技术实现,以保证数据的实时性和一致性。
4. 故障检测与切换
CDN 多路灾备通过实时监控各个数据中心的状态,一旦发现故障,会立即启动故障切换机制,将用户流量从故障数据中心切换到正常的数据中心,这个过程通常是无感知的,用户无需进行任何操作即可继续访问网站。
二、CDN 多路灾备实施步骤
1. 选择合适的 CDN服务商
需要选择一家具有丰富经验和良好口碑的 CDN 服务商,这家服务商应该具备全球范围的数据中心分布,以满足不同地区的访问需求,还需要关注服务商的技术实力和服务水平,确保能够满足企业的业务需求。
2. 部署 CDN 节点
在选择了合适的 CDN 服务商后,需要在其全球范围内部署 CDN 节点,这些节点通常位于各大城市和地区,以覆盖全球主要的互联网接入点,在部署过程中,需要根据企业的业务需求和访问特点,合理规划节点的数量和位置。
3. 配置负载均衡策略
在部署了 CDN 节点后,需要为其配置负载均衡策略,这通常包括以下几个方面:根据用户的地理位置和网络状况,动态调整节点的负载分配;设置合理的缓存策略,降低源站的压力;实现故障切换和容错功能,确保在节点出现故障时,用户流量可以自动切换到其他正常的节点。
4. 监控与优化
在完成了 CDN 多路灾备的实施后,还需要对其进行持续的监控和优化,这包括定期检查各个节点的运行状态和性能指标;收集用户的访问数据和反馈信息,以便及时发现和解决潜在的问题;根据业务发展和技术进步,不断调整和优化 CDN 多路灾备策略,以提高其性能和可用性。
三、相关问题与解答
1. CDN 多路灾备是否适用于所有类型的网站?
答:是的,CDN 多路灾备适用于所有类型的网站,包括企业级应用、电商平台、社交网站等,通过使用 CDN 多路灾备技术,可以确保用户在任何时候都可以快速、稳定地访问网站内容,提高用户体验和满意度。
2. CDN 多路灾备是否会影响网站的加载速度?
答:在大多数情况下,CDN 多路灾备不会对网站的加载速度产生明显影响,因为 CDN 节点通常距离用户较近,可以减少网络传输的时间和延迟,CDN 多路灾备采用负载均衡和智能缓存等技术,可以在保证内容最新的同时,提高访问速度和效率。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/57905.html